Transaction 71ad4195fe5f860fe644a197c31c01ad2001e559cc43a4565c9b940bdcc14a16

1 Input
2 Outputs
  • 71ad4195fe5f860fe644a197c31c01ad2001e559cc43a4565c9b940bdcc14a16:0
  • value  644863
    address  3LPSeMnYVQJdnwCA3Pvg3HQK9GuHVBEujc
  • 71ad4195fe5f860fe644a197c31c01ad2001e559cc43a4565c9b940bdcc14a16:1
  • value  22896922
    address  bc1qx9jyle3d2juxacd88zk9mlemxcwx6kenprrk93kp2nr08kul6hxqpgtg4e